PhotoshopCAFE - Lightroom 3 for Digital Photographers.
English | 7.5 Hours | 960x600 | H264 | 30fps 2248kbps | AAC 77kbps | 1.34GB


Colin Smith



Learn Lightroom Inside-Out!
The most Comprehensive Guide for Lightroom 3


This is the most comprehensive video on the market for Lightroom. Learn how to import, organize, develop and output all your captures with effortless ease. Enjoy in-depth coverage, pro techniques, secret tips and Colin’s way of breaking down even the most complex tasks into quick and easy to understand techniques. The Author



Colin Smith is founder of the #1 PhotoshopCAFE online community which has received over 20 million visitors.

Colin has Authored/Coauthored 18 books. He has won numerous awards including 3 Guru awards. He’s been nominated for the Photoshop Hall of Fame twice. Colin is a regular columnist for Photoshop User Magazine. He’s been featured in almost every major imaging magazine, and is in high demand as a speaker at major industry events including Flash Forward and WPPI . He consults such companies as ABC Disney, Apple and Adobe
